Working party about to start off in the rain wearing waterproof sheets and trench waders
Digging different types of holes, such as dugouts and trenches, comprised a large part of a soldier’s life on the Western Front, and this image shows a working party about to set off on such a duty. Equipped with shovels, the already mud-splattered troops are wearing trench waders and capes to protect them against the rain and mud.
